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
977514 93512 536276367 6319 2941059665
0077 17120
0077 17120
059732 18 52
All about undefined
Interested in learning more?
0077 17120
059732 18 52
See more
87641989002 763 3748694
90861 3269133 0118941 1948 7628502
See more
56319649 88 184118
78 93436744 92279941975 6546 63734
See more